
Six new guests have been announced to be attending this year’s Star Wars Celebration, including the talents behind a fan-favourite Force wielder and the galaxy’s most infamous bounty hunter (now all grown up), have been confirmed for the Topps autograph area.
The newly announced guests are: Ashley Eckstein voice of Ahsoka Tano on Star Wars: The Clone Wars and Star Wars: Rebels, Daniel Logan aka Boba Fett in Episode II: Attack of the Clones and Star Wars: The Clone Wars, Jett Lucas Zett Jukassa in Episode II Attack of the Clones and Episode III: Revenge of the Sith son of George Lucas, Ken Leung Admiral Statura in Episode VII: The Force Awakens, Katy Kartwheel creature performer in Episode VII: The Force Awakens and Episode VIII: The Last Jedi, and John Ratzenberger Major Derlin in Episode V: The Empire Strikes Back.
Previously announced guests include Joonas Suotamo who has taken over the role of Chewbacca from Episode VIII: The Last Jedi onward, Sam Witwer voice of Darth Maul in Star Wars: The Clone Wars, Star Wars: Rebels and Solo: A Star Wars Story. Greg Grunberg, who brought Resistance X-wing pilot Snap Wexley to the screen in Episode VII: The Force Awakens. Dave Chapman, the puppeteer who has helped bring BB-8, Rio Durant, and Lady Proxima to life in the Sequel Trilogy and Solo: A Star Wars Story. Greg Proops, who has lent his voice most recently to Star Wars Resistance as Jak Sivrak and Garma, and previously voiced Fode in Episode I: The Phantom Menace. Paul Kasey, who played Admiral Raddus in Rogue One: A Star Wars Story and Ello Asty in Episode VII: The Force Awakens. Ian McElhinney, who played General Dodonna in Rogue One: A Star Wars Story. And Orli Shoshan, Shaak Ti in both Episode II: Attack of the Clones and Episode III: Revenge of the Sith.
Star Wars Celebration Chicago will be taking place in 68 days time at the McCormick Place from April 11th to the 15th.
